Artist Bio:
Frankie Miller is a Scottish rock singer-songwriter who gained prominence in the 1970s and 1980s. Born on November 2, 1949, in Bridgeton, Glasgow, Miller started his music career in various bands before launching a successful solo career. He is known for his soulful voice and bluesy rock style, which garnered him a dedicated following.


Miller released several albums throughout his career, including "Once in a Blue Moon" and "The Rock" which featured collaborations with renowned musicians such as Phil Lynott and Chrissie Hynde. Despite experiencing a setback in the early 1990s due to a brain hemorrhage, Miller continued to make music and perform live. He has been praised by critics for his powerful vocals and heartfelt songwriting, cementing his status as a respected figure in the rock music scene.
